Calibration is used to adjust what aspect?

Explanation:
Calibration determines how much product is delivered per unit area, so it is used to adjust the rate of application to meet the label’s recommended rate. The potency of the pesticide is set by its formulation and concentration and isn’t changed by calibration. Storage temperature and timing are about conditions and scheduling, not how much product is sprayed. In practice, calibration means measuring the actual output over a known distance or area and then adjusting nozzle size, system pressure, or travel speed to reach the target rate.
